Perfect Square
169138811065383209976021081235048184178393746195102691650390625 is a perfect square (13005337791283362509047681640625 × 13005337791283362509047681640625)
169138811065383209976021081235048184178393746195102691650390625 is a perfect square (13005337791283362509047681640625 × 13005337791283362509047681640625)
169138811065383209976021081235048184178393746195102691650390625 is odd
Previous odd number is 169138811065383209976021081235048184178393746195102691650390623
Next odd number is 169138811065383209976021081235048184178393746195102691650390627
110100101000001010111011111111101001010100000011111001010011100110100010111001101010111010000101011111101111000011111110011101101100010100100101001010001010101011101001101000010000101100100110100101001100001
4838712520325431762440866210438199984973931586412709285218962526305078804168948686549432744127714849785330858433625585897701029229755112738695720709325431840852616005577147006988525390625
28607937408611397793690052528829385437496478360196236433841675020901480545335037182926524668207272203289903700351715087890625
645012737751240371234642715272053757037635542445121253515020544645141